The Guardians of New Zealand Superannuation is an innovative, award-winning global investor. Our primary role is to manage the NZ Super Fund, an investment fund which invests taxpayer contributions globally to help pre-fund universal superannuation in New Zealand. Our team has a deep sense of purpose through the work we do to benefit future generations of New Zealanders. At the Guardians there’s an energy, passion and a shared commitment to excellence. The Applications Development team is responsible for our investment-related data and technology services. We deliver the tools and data required to ensure that our investment-related data can be trusted, understood and traced, while creating and maintaining high quality decision support tools.


A recent review of the Applications Development team has led to the creation of a newly designated Technical Support team, which sits between the business and the development team. The team will manage level 2 support and some level 1, when required. In time, the role is expected to contribute to level 3 enhancements. Leading this small team will be the newly created Manager, Investment Applications Technical Support, who will be involved in recruiting another supporting team member.
